Rusted steel panels are widely used in architecture and landscape design, especially when made from weathering steel (commonly known as Corten steel). Their unique red-brown surface is not just “rusted steel” in a traditional sense—it is a controlled corrosion layer that behaves very differently from ordinary carbon steel rust.

What Happens When Steel Rusts?

All steel contains iron (Фе). When exposed to oxygen and moisture, it naturally forms iron oxide (ржавчина). Однако, the behavior of this rust depends strongly on the steel composition.

Существует два основных типа:

  • Unstable rust (ordinary carbon steel)
  • Stable protective rust (Corten weathering steel)

Rust on Ordinary Carbon Steel

When normal steel is exposed outdoors:

  • Rust forms quickly on the surface
  • The rust layer is porous and flaky
  • Moisture and oxygen continue penetrating the surface
  • Rust keeps spreading deeper into the material

Характеристики:

  • Непрерывная коррозия
  • Rust flakes fall off easily
  • Surface keeps deteriorating
  • Requires paint or coating protection
  • Shorter service life in outdoor environments

👉 The rust acts as a non-protective layer

Rust on Corten Steel Panels

Кортеновская сталь (атмосферостойкая сталь) is designed to behave differently. It contains small amounts of alloying elements such as copper (Cu), хром (Кр), и никель (В).

When exposed to weather:

1. Начальное образование ржавчины

  • Similar to carbon steel at first
  • Surface turns orange-brown

2. Stabilization Phase

  • Alloy elements modify the oxide structure
  • Rust layer becomes dense and tightly bonded

3. Формирование защитной патины

  • A stable “rust skin” forms
  • It blocks oxygen and moisture penetration
  • Corrosion rate slows dramatically

Why Corten Steel Rust Looks More Uniform

Rusted steel panels made from Corten steel have a more controlled and aesthetic appearance because:

  • Rust develops evenly over time
  • Wet/dry weather cycles stabilize the surface
  • The patina becomes visually consistent
  • No continuous flaking exposes fresh steel

This creates the signature deep red-brown architectural finish used in modern design.

Why Ordinary Rust Looks “Damaged”

In carbon steel panels:

  • Rust layers break apart
  • Fresh metal is repeatedly exposed
  • Corrosion spreads unevenly
  • Surface becomes rough and unstable

This results in a damaged, powdery, and structurally weakening surface.
